The Group B Streptococcus (GBS) alpha-like protein (Alp) family consists of several large surface-anchored proteins, including Alpha C, Rib, Alp1, Alp2, Alp3, Alp4, and R28, which are key virulence factors in Streptococcus agalactiae (UniProt P13515, P26753). These proteins are characterized by a conserved N-terminal domain and a variable number of identical tandem repeats that facilitate bacterial interaction with host tissues (PMID: 26055475). Biologically, Alp family members function as adhesins, enabling the bacteria to attach to and invade human epithelial cells in the vaginal and respiratory tracts (PMID: 15342475). They also play a critical role in immune evasion by interfering with opsonophagocytosis and protecting the pathogen from host clearance. Clinically, GBS is a leading cause of neonatal sepsis, meningitis, and pneumonia, making these proteins high-priority targets for vaccine development (PMID: 30452636). Current therapeutic strategies focus on using recombinant N-terminal domains or fusion proteins to induce broad-spectrum immunity across multiple GBS serotypes. Ongoing clinical trials, such as those for the GBS6 and Minervax vaccines, aim to prevent maternal colonization and vertical transmission to infants by targeting these conserved antigens.
